Truist Financial Corp trimmed its holdings in TE Connectivity Ltd. (NYSE:TEL - Free Report) by 1.4% in the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 116,513 shares of the electronics maker's stock after selling 1,623 shares during the quarter. Truist Financial Corp's holdings in TE Connectivity were worth $19,652,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

TE Connectivity (NYSE:TEL -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, July 23rd. The electronics maker reported $2.27 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$2.08 by $0.19. The company had revenue of $4.53 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$4.30 billion. TE Connectivity had a net margin of 8.78% and a return on equity of 20.22%. The firm's revenue for the quarter was up 13.9%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the prior year, the company posted $1.91 EPS. TE Connectivity has set its Q4 2025 guidance at 2.270-2.270 EPS. As a group, equities research analysts forecast that TE Connectivity Ltd. will post 8.05 EPS for the current year.

TE Connectivity Profile
(
Free Report)
TE Connectivity Ltd., together with its subsidiaries, manufactures and sells connectivity and sensor solutions in Europe, the Middle East, Africa, the AsiaPacific, and the Americas. The company operates through three segments: Transportation Solutions, Industrial Solutions, and Communications Solutions.
